Historical Roots of Egyptian-Themed Slot Games

Egyptian-themed slots owe their popularity to the rich visual symbolism and the mystique of ancient Egyptian civilisation. From Pharaohs and gods like Horus and Anubis, to iconic hieroglyphs and grand pyramids, these motifs create an immersive experience that appeals to players’ fascination with antiquity and mystery. The earliest implementations in the online gaming sector appeared in the early 2000s, but it was during the rise of mobile gaming in the 2010s that such themes surged in prominence.

Industry data demonstrates that Egyptian-themed slots often boast higher engagement metrics. For instance, a 2022 report by Statista indicated that Egyptian-themed titles account for approximately 15% of all innovative new slot releases, a figure that underscores their sustained popularity among operators and players alike.

The Psychological and Cultural Appeal

“Themes rooted in mythology and history tap into collective unconscious archetypes, fostering emotional connection and curiosity.” – Dr. Eleanor Whitcomb, Cultural Psychologist

This psychological angle is critical. Egyptian symbols like the Eye of Horus, scarabs, and the Sphinx trigger subconscious recognition and associations with protection, luck, and mysticism. These themes also facilitate storytelling within the game mechanics, elevating player immersion from mere chance to an engaging mythological journey.

Spotlight on Authenticity and Ethics

As the genre matures, the importance of cultural authenticity and ethical storytelling rises. Misappropriation or trivialisation of Egyptian symbols can lead to backlash, both culturally and legally. Industry leaders advocate for collaboration with Egyptology experts and cultural advisors, ensuring respectful representations. These efforts foster trust among players and uphold the integrity of the themes.
